Tactless people end up to be lonely.Tactfulness is akin to telling white lies or not being economical with the truth.The questions are, where do we draw the lines between what is white lies and blatant deceptions, deceitfulness, cover ups and mistruths?

I think the line is pretty clear...

If the lie is told to protect someone else's feelings, then this is likely acceptable

If the lie told to protect yourself or would be seen as a betrayal of trust by your partner if they knew the truth, this is not acceptable
